Product Overview: FMMT2222ATA from Diodes Incorporated
The FMMT2222ATA is a high-performance NPN bipolar junction transistor (BJT) from Diodes Incorporated, designed for use in a wide range of electronic applications. This small-signal transistor is known for its reliability and efficiency, making it an ideal choice for designers and engineers looking to optimize their circuit designs.
Key Features:
- High Current Gain: With a high current gain bandwidth product (fT), the FMMT2222ATA ensures excellent amplification characteristics for both audio and high-frequency signals.
- Low Saturation Voltage: The transistor has a low collector-emitter saturation voltage, which minimizes power loss and improves overall efficiency in switching applications.
- High Collector Current: It supports a continuous collector current up to 600 mA, making it suitable for driving moderate loads.
- Power Dissipation: Capable of dissipating up to 625 mW of power, the FMMT2222ATA can handle a fair amount of power for its size.
- Operating Temperature Range: This device can operate over a wide temperature range from -55°C to +150°C, ensuring stability and performance under varying environmental conditions.

The FMMT2222ATA transistor is housed in a SOT-23 package, which is a compact, surface-mount package that is suitable for automated assembly processes. This package design allows for efficient use of PCB space, making it an excellent choice for space-constrained applications.
